The QuinLED An-Penta-Plus is a flagship analog LED dimmer with five analog channels plus a digital output (six in total) for 12–48V single-colour, RGB, RGBW and tunable-white strips, driving up to 10A per channel and 30A total. It runs flicker-free ~20kHz PWM, offers both WiFi and wired Ethernet with replaceable fuses in a finned aluminium case, and starts from $39.99.
The An-Penta-Plus is the dimmer for serious analog installs — bright architectural lighting, a tunable-white ceiling you intend to film, or a Meanwell-fed run that has to hold a rock-steady colour on camera. The high per-channel current drives long, dense tape, wired Ethernet keeps it dependable in a structured install, and the extra digital output can run a short addressable accent alongside the five analog channels.
